## Service Accounts: Wavecrest Preview

Wavecrest renders audio waveform previews for the Nightjar media library. One service account, read-only on source audio, write on the preview bucket. No human logins. Rotation: 90 days, enforced by the Keyloft rotator. Scope was audited last quarter; no wildcard grants remain. The account authenticates to the Keyloft broker with the key below.

gateway credential: kto23_LX9A4ys6i4nzHtpOLNLodKK

Subject: Release 2.9 — pagination changes in the Ostlane public API

Team,

Release 2.9 of the Ostlane REST API replaces offset pagination with opaque cursors on all list endpoints. Offset parameters will be accepted but ignored after the deprecation window, so please update client examples in the contractor onboarding docs. Cursor tokens expire after ten minutes; handle the expiry error gracefully. The build token for this release is included below.

session token of kageg-tahop = htk14_af3c1ccccb7dcf

Subject: Autocomplete index cut-over — done!

Hey Priya,

Welcome aboard! Quick recap: we finished moving the sluggish Quillhatch autocomplete index over to the new Tarnwood shards last night. Lookups dropped from ~900 ms to under 80 ms, and the nightly rebuild now finishes before breakfast. Old index is read-only until Friday, then gone. To point your local environment at the new shards, use the settings just below.

deployment values, tafog-fajef:
[jorox]
team = norael
access_code = ac_b6e7bf
owner = oliael.silwyn
host = jorox.qorveltech.internal
port = 8443
peer = oliius.paliqlabs.local
salt = 0b6288ee
pin = 8391